<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: K22 I2C0 pull downs crash I2C bus in Kinetis Microcontrollers</title>
    <link>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664267#M40825</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Kevin&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I think that a non-powered K22 will look like a diode to GND to the I2C bus (due to its passive GPIO protection circuitry). Probably you need to put MOSFET switches on the two lines and only switch them on when the K22 is powered.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Regards&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Mark&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Thu, 05 Jan 2017 21:04:55 GMT</pubDate>
    <dc:creator>mjbcswitzerland</dc:creator>
    <dc:date>2017-01-05T21:04:55Z</dc:date>
    <item>
      <title>K22 I2C0 pull downs crash I2C bus</title>
      <link>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664266#M40824</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I'm working with the K22 and removed power from the chip, however kept I2C0_SDA and I2C0_CLK on PORTB connected to the I2C bus. &amp;nbsp;When I keep them connected while the chip is powered down, it pulls the entire I2C bus down. &amp;nbsp;When I remove the K22 from the bus, the bus operates as it should. &am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;What can I do, from the K22 side, to prevent this from happening, as I believe the pull-down is internal to the chip itself?&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 05 Jan 2017 20:35:57 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664266#M40824</guid>
      <dc:creator>kevinlfw</dc:creator>
      <dc:date>2017-01-05T20:35:57Z</dc:date>
    </item>
    <item>
      <title>Re: K22 I2C0 pull downs crash I2C bus</title>
      <link>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664267#M40825</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Kevin&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I think that a non-powered K22 will look like a diode to GND to the I2C bus (due to its passive GPIO protection circuitry). Probably you need to put MOSFET switches on the two lines and only switch them on when the K22 is powered.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Regards&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Mark&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 05 Jan 2017 21:04:55 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664267#M40825</guid>
      <dc:creator>mjbcswitzerland</dc:creator>
      <dc:date>2017-01-05T21:04:55Z</dc:date>
    </item>
    <item>
      <title>Re: K22 I2C0 pull downs crash I2C bus</title>
      <link>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664268#M40826</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Exactly that cause -- I would go with a 'fully pre-designed' isolation concept like PCA9617A, or such from that family.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 06 Jan 2017 01:31:28 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Kinetis-Microcontrollers/K22-I2C0-pull-downs-crash-I2C-bus/m-p/664268#M40826</guid>
      <dc:creator>egoodii</dc:creator>
      <dc:date>2017-01-06T01:31:28Z</dc:date>
    </item>
  </channel>
</rss>

